I managed to find another Fuji S5 Pro for a good price (I absolutely love the camera!). And am planning on converting it to IR to replace my IR converted D70. However sending it to the states could be incredibly expensive (Depending on how customs feels).

So was hoping someone would have some knowledge of a place / person in Canada that can do the work?

    MaxMax and LifePixel are the 2 services I am aware of for IR conversion. MaxMax and LifePixel are indeed out of the USA, but I believe that you can order the IR replacement filter from LifePixel and any competent camera repair shop may be able to do the conversion for you.
